HIDDEN WATER INC

UEI: GELWJ7YV1RM5CAGE: 3UPZ8

HIDDEN WATER INC is a federal contractor, registered under UEI GELWJ7YV1RM5 and CAGE code 3UPZ8. It has been awarded $75,493,210 across 4,647 federal contracts. Primary work spans Hazardous Waste Treatment and Disposal, Remediation Services, and Environmental Consulting Services. Top awarding agencies include Department Of Defense, Department Of The Interior, and Department Of Justice.

Hidden Water Inc. specializes in environmental remediation, hazardous waste management, and scientific consulting services for federal land and public health agencies. The company delivers field-based environmental assessments, noxious weed inventory and control, medical waste disposal, and hazardous waste treatment and collection services. Their technical expertise includes remedial investigation/feasibility studies (RI/FE), environmental compliance documentation, and integrated waste stream management under RCRA and EPA guidelines. A key differentiator is their ability to combine on-the-ground field operations with technical reporting for complex federal sites, particularly in remote or culturally sensitive areas such as Native American trust lands. The contractor maintains a strong, recurring relationship with the Department of the Interior, where they conduct environmental assessments, invasive species management, and ecological monitoring on public lands. They also serve the Department of Defense with hazardous waste treatment and disposal for military installations and the Department of Health and Human Services with medical waste handling for federal health centers. Their work for these agencies consistently involves regulatory compliance, site-specific planning, and coordination with tribal and state authorities. Their primary industry focus lies in hazardous waste treatment and disposal (562211), remediation services (562910), and scientific consulting (541690), positioning them as a niche provider for federal environmental compliance and ecological stewardship. They specialize in serving agencies managing natural resources, military cleanup programs, and public health infrastructure, with an emphasis on actionable field data and documented remediation outcomes. Hidden Water Inc. is a small business structured as a 2L entity based in Owasso, Oklahoma. While they hold no formal government certifications, their consistent performance across high-regulation environments demonstrates operational maturity and familiarity with federal environmental protocols. Their geographic presence is defined by project-based deployments across the western and southwestern United States, particularly in regions under DOI and DoD jurisdiction.

Corydon Well Replacement Project – Professional Design, Bidding Support and Engineering Services During Construction
Solicitation # C2305
The Elsinore Valley Municipal Water District (EVMWD) is soliciting proposals for the Corydon Well Replacement Project, which involves the professional design, bidding support, and engineering services required to replace and abandon the existing Corydon well in Wildomar, California. The project is divided into two primary phases: Phase 1 focuses on civil site design, technical specifications, and construction management for the drilling of the new well and abandonment of the old one; Phase 2 covers the architectural, civil, mechanical, structural, electrical, and instrumentation design for equipping, testing, and commissioning the new groundwater production well. The project is funded through District funds and a Department of the Interior Bureau of Reclamation WaterSMART Planning and Project Design Grant, necessitating compliance with federal requirements, including the Build America Act, Buy America Preference, and the use of the Automated Standard Application for Payments (ASAP) system. TKE Engineering, Inc. is seeking qualified DBE, MBE, and WBE firms specializing in hydrology/hydraulic consulting, structural and electrical engineering, geotechnical investigation, and utility potholing. Proposals are due by 10:00 a.m. on September 1, 2026, via the PlanetBids Vendor Portal. Selection is based on demonstrated competence and professional qualifications, with evaluation weighted toward relevant experience (25%), project approach (25%), and scope/schedule (20%), while cost and innovation each account for 10%. The total estimated project cost is 2,260,788 dollars, though the final contract will be a negotiated not-to-exceed dollar limit. Awardees must adhere to strict federal and state regulations, including whistleblower protections, drug-free workplace standards, and specific insurance and bonding requirements for contracts exceeding the simplified acquisition threshold.

WOJC - Asbestos Abatement (Food Service and Wellness Department)
Solicitation # WOJC – Asbestos Abatement (Food Service and Wellness Department)
Education and Training Resources is soliciting quotes for a subcontracting opportunity to perform asbestos abatement services at the Westover Job Corps Center in Chicopee, Massachusetts. The scope of work involves the removal and disposal of asbestos-containing materials in two primary locations: the Food Service Building mop room area and the Administration Building Wellness Department, specifically targeting approximately 10 linear feet of heat pipe insulation in the hallway ceiling. The selected contractor must provide all labor, materials, and equipment, ensuring strict compliance with EPA, OSHA, and state regulations. Key deliverables include the safe containment and HEPA vacuuming of materials, proper disposal at licensed facilities with documented manifests, and the maintenance of daily logs. Final project acceptance requires a signed punch list and applicable warranties, with a third-party hygienist provided by the center for air monitoring and clearance testing. Bids are due by September 11, 2026, and must be submitted as a fee-for-service proposal including a detailed cost breakdown and a proposed service schedule. To be eligible, bidders must provide a W-9, vendor acknowledgement form, certificates of insurance, and all required Massachusetts licensing and credentials. Winning bidders must possess an active SAM.gov registration and a Unique Entity ID. The award process is not based solely on the lowest price, as ETR serves as the sole judge of the selection. The contract incorporates several federal regulations, including the Service Contract Act, the Davis-Bacon Act, and anti-lobbying certifications. Bonding requirements apply based on project value, with specific thresholds for payment and performance bonds for projects exceeding 35,000 dollars.
